About First Trust NASDAQ Cybersecurity ETF

The fund will normally invest at least 90% of its net assets (including investment borrowings) in the common stocks and depositary receipts that comprise the index. The index includes securities of companies classified as cyber security companies. The fund is non-diversified.

About 10X Genomics Inc

10x Genomics Inc is a life science technology company based in the United States. Its solutions include instruments, consumables, and software for analyzing biological systems. The product portfolio of the company includes Chromium Controller, Reagent Kits, 10x Compatible Products, and Informatics Software among others. The majority of its revenue is generated from consumables.
